Before we dive into the secrets, it’s essential to understand the admission process at USC. The university uses a holistic approach to review applications, considering factors such as academic performance, standardized test scores, extracurricular activities, and personal statements. The admission committee looks for students who demonstrate a strong academic record, a passion for learning, and a commitment to making a positive impact in their communities.

Secret #1: Meet the Academic Requirements

To be considered for admission, you must meet the minimum academic requirements, which include a GPA of 3.7 or higher, completion of challenging coursework, and satisfactory scores on the SAT or ACT. It’s crucial to note that meeting the minimum requirements does not guarantee admission, as the admission committee considers a range of factors beyond academic performance.

Extracurricular Activities

USC values students who are involved in extracurricular activities, such as sports, music, or community service. It’s essential to demonstrate a passion for a particular activity or cause and show how it has helped you develop valuable skills, such as leadership, teamwork, or communication.

Secret #5: Develop a Passion Project

A passion project can demonstrate your commitment to a particular cause or activity and showcase your skills and talents. Choose a project that aligns with your academic interests and strengths and work on it consistently to develop a strong portfolio.

Secret #6: Seek Leadership Opportunities

Leadership opportunities can help you develop valuable skills, such as communication, problem-solving, and decision-making. Seek out leadership roles in clubs, organizations, or community groups and work on developing your leadership skills to increase your chances of admission.

Personal Statement

The personal statement is a critical component of the USC application, as it allows you to tell your story and showcase your personality. It’s essential to write a compelling and authentic personal statement that highlights your strengths, passions, and goals.

Secret #7: Tell a Compelling Story

Your personal statement should tell a story that showcases your personality, values, and goals. Use specific examples and anecdotes to illustrate your points and make sure to proofread your statement carefully to ensure that it is error-free and polished.

Secret #8: Show, Don’t Tell

Rather than simply stating your qualities or characteristics, show them through specific examples and anecdotes. This will help you create a more compelling and authentic personal statement that showcases your strengths and passions.
